    Rookie Draft

    Sydney was excluded from today's Pre-season Draft because the senior list is full, but the Swans added five names to the 2004 Rookie list (in addition to Paul Bevan, who was carried over from 2003).

    Scott McGlone was reinstated after being dropped from last year's rookie list, and Daniel Hunt was taken for the rookies after being delisted from the Swans' senior squad.

    The new faces are -

    AARON ROGERS 05/01/1984 192cm 86kg

    A former St George/NSW-ACT U18 player who was previously drafted by Melbourne in 2001 (2nd round pick) but delisted at the end of 2003. A key forward player who had a run for the Demons in the 2003 Wizard Cup, but spent the season proper with Sandringham in the VFL.

    LUKE TAYLOR 21/01/85 191cm 81kg

    Originally from Culcairn/Lavington and represented NSW in the U18 Championships. Luke played most of 2003 in the forward line for the Murray Bushrangers (including 8 marks and 3 goals against the Rams), but was moved into defence late in the season, and ended up rating as the Bushrangers' best defender (at CHB) in their TAC Grand Final loss to the Cannons.

    Luke stood out as the best of the potential rookies invited to train with the Swans (the others being Shaun Daly and Luke Schilg).

    Recruiting manager Ricky Barham said, "Taylor is an athletic forward and can take a good grab."

    NICK POTTER 12/06/85 181cm 80kg

    Midfielder from Pennant Hills who represented NSW in the U18 Championships and filled-in for the Swans Reserves in the Canberra League.

    Nick was the outstanding youngster playing local football in Sydney in 2003, and was awarded the 2003 National Bank Rising Star Award for Sydney Football, as well as being Pennant Hill's "Footballer of the Year".
